Get ready for the Skoda Enyaq unveiling at Skoda India's event on 27th Feb - anticipation is building!
Key Highlights:
Skoda Auto India is going to hold an event on 27th February 2024. The scheduled event has sparked speculation regarding the unveiling of the all new first electric car from Skoda. Not much has been unveiled regarding this upcoming event of 27th February, except for the invitation which reads, “ As we step into the “New ERA of Skoda”, we cordially invite you to join us for an important brand announcement.”
The brand is known for its competitiveness, innovation, technology, performance and No wonder, this event is going to be a crucial moment in the growth journey of Skoda in the Indian Market. With the sudden and unclear invitation the brand has left the media and automotive industry in suspense.
The key term to be noted in this invitation is “New Era of Skoda” , this signifies a possible new generation of Skoda in India, significantly the EV Era. With that said, we can assume the launch of Enyaq iV very soon.
For the all electric Enyaq, Skoda has chosen the CBU (Completely Built Unit) route, However, the Czech car maker might consider the CKD (Completely Knocked Down) if the demand is enough in India. This means the Enyaq will be imported directly in India and therefore it will incur heavy import duty.
The Enyaq iV is based on the VW Group’s born-electric MEB platform. The Skoda measures 1,877mm wide and 4,648mm long – though it is slightly smaller than the Skoda Kodiaq, however it is strictly a two-row SUV.
We can expect to get the premium Enyaq iV 80x, which will be equipped with a 77kWh battery and dual motors. The dual motors are expected to be on each axle, simulating All Wheel Drive (AWD) that makes 265hp.
Moreover it is expected that the battery pack will support 125kW DC fast charging, which can even go up to 513km (WLTP) on a single charge.
This upcoming Skoda Enyaq will be Skoda’s first Premium Electric AWD capable SUV. We expect Skoda to price it between Rs 45 Lakh to Rs 55 Lakh (ex-showroom). At this price range it will compete with rivals like Hyundai Ioniq 5, Volvo XC40 Recharge, BYD Atto 3, etc.
Skoda Auto India's upcoming event on February 27th, 2024, hints at the debut of the anticipated Skoda Enyaq iV, with its cutting-edge features and competitive pricing, promises to challenge rivals in the premium electric SUV segment.
